Earlier on today Municipality of Lephalale have revealed that area such as Onverwacht will be out of water for a while.

Here is the statement released by Municipality:

Residents of Onverwacht are informed that a pipe burst has occurred at Kameeldoring Street, resulting in an interruption of the water supply to certain areas of Onverwacht.

The Municipal Maintenance Team is currently isolating the affected valves to undertake the necessary repairs.

According to the works[maintenance team] job is expected to done and dust before sunset by 17:00 today.
